Overview

In Austin, Texas, Ascension Seton Southwest Hospital offers 24/7 emergency care. They specialize in general, orthopedic, gynecology, and robotic surgeries, as well as colonoscopy procedures. Moreover, their care team offers cardiac rehabilitation, cardiovascular diagnostics, a comprehensive range of imaging services, and both adult and pediatric outpatient rehabilitation care—all conveniently located on a single campus. Their services encompass Cardiac Rehabilitation, Colonoscopy, Emergency Care, Gynecology, Minimally Invasive Surgery, Orthopedics, Physical Therapy, Radiology, Robotic Surgery, and Surgery.
